Broasted Chicken
Broasted Chicken
Our chicken is lightly dusted with wheat flour, placed in a broaster where it is heat sealed, and cooked under steam pressure. Then, in the same machine it is quickly browned in 100% pure canola oil, producing a well done moist product. You will taste the difference as our exclusive marination gives you that all the way to the bone flavor. It is tender, juicy and delicious
